This episode of the BBC World Service Global News Podcast covers several significant international stories. It starts with reports of suspected Russian sabotage on an undersea power cable between Finland and Estonia, which has led to a heightened NATO naval presence in the Baltic Sea. Next, the podcast delves into the political upheaval in South Korea following the impeachment of the acting president. Further sections address the forced evacuation of a hospital in Gaza by Israeli forces and the increasing strain on Israel's reservist army due to its prolonged multi-front conflict. The discussion then shifts to Nepal, where an unexpected rise in the tiger population is leading to human-wildlife conflicts. The episode wraps up with a brief note about a new series exploring allegations of abuse in a global yoga network.
